Multiplication Game: Four or More

Since we finished up our first mid-module assessment in math, we decided to have a fun Friday! The students learned the game, Four or More, which is a fun and strategic way to practice math facts! Here are the rules of the game:

  • You may only use facts 1-9 (no 0,10,11,12)
  • Your goal is to get 4 x's or o's in a row (think Connect Four) horizontally, vertically, or diagonally
  • Each player plays 10 rounds. Whomever had the highest score at the end of the rounds wins
